Objective evaluation of size and shape of superficial foveal avascular zone in normal subjects by optical coherence tomography angiography
This study was conducted to investigate the size and shape of the foveal avascular zone (FAZ) determined by optical coherence tomography angiography (OCTA) and the relationship of the size and shape to the clinical findings in normal subjects.
